What alternatives reduce mowing and maintenance in my Randolph yard?

Replacing high-maintenance turf with Eastern Redbud, Sweet Pepperbush, and Little Bluestem creates a climate-adaptive xeriscape that thrives in Zone 6b. This approach reduces weekly mowing needs while supporting 2026 biodiversity standards. Electric equipment operates quietly within noise ordinances, and native plants require minimal irrigation once established, conserving water long-term.

Are concrete pavers or wood better for Randolph patios?

Concrete pavers and bluestone outperform wood in Randolph's climate, lasting 25+ years versus wood's 10-15 year lifespan with maintenance. These materials support Moderate Fire Wise Rating (WUI Zone 2) compliance by creating defensible space without combustible elements. Their thermal mass moderates temperature extremes while withstanding Zone 6b freeze-thaw cycles better than organic alternatives.

How do I control invasive species without violating fertilizer laws?

Japanese stiltgrass and garlic mustard pose significant risks in Randolph's acidic soils. Manual removal before seed set avoids NJ Fertilizer Law restrictions on phosphorus applications. For persistent issues, targeted spot treatments with mycorrhizae-enriched compost improve soil health while suppressing invasives. Always time applications outside blackout dates and verify need through soil testing first.

How do I maintain healthy grass during Randolph's water restrictions?

Wi-Fi ET-based weather sensing controllers automatically adjust irrigation to actual evapotranspiration rates, reducing water use 20-30% while preserving Kentucky Bluegrass and Tall Fescue blends. These systems comply with Stage 1 voluntary conservation by preventing overwatering during Randolph's frequent rainfall events. Proper programming accounts for sandy loam's quick drainage, applying water in shorter, more frequent cycles to minimize runoff.

Why does my Randolph yard have such poor drainage and compacted soil?

With Randolph homes averaging 1978 construction, your soil has matured for 48 years, developing compaction layers from decades of foot traffic and equipment use. Mount Freedom's acidic sandy loam naturally has low organic matter, which reduces permeability over time. Core aeration every 2-3 years with compost amendments addresses this by improving soil structure and water infiltration. This approach is particularly effective for Randolph's pH 5.5-6.2 soil conditions.

What solutions work for Randolph's high runoff and water table issues?

Acidic sandy loam in localized low-lands requires French drains or dry wells to manage Randolph's high water table. Permeable concrete pavers or bluestone installations meet Randolph Township Planning & Zoning Department runoff standards by allowing 80-90% infiltration. These systems work with the soil's natural 5.5-6.2 pH range while preventing basement flooding common in Mount Freedom's topography.

What permits and licenses are needed for grading my 0.75-acre lot?

Grading work on 0.75 acres requires a permit from Randolph Township Planning & Zoning Department and a licensed Home Improvement Contractor through the NJ Division of Consumer Affairs. Professional licensing ensures proper erosion control and drainage planning, particularly important given Randolph's high runoff hazards. Unlicensed grading risks fines and may void property insurance in flood-prone areas of Mount Freedom.
